WebSorted by: 6. The amount of energy needed to heat 1kg of water by 1°C is given by the specific heat of water. This changes slightly with temperature, but it's around 4.2 kJ/kg/K. So suppose we have a mass m kg of water and we are heating it by T degrees (e.g. from 20°C to boiling would be T = 80°C). The amount of energy needed is: E = 4.2 m ... To calculate the amount of heat energy needed to heat a pot with its content of water we can use a simple formula: Δ H = m c p ( T 2 − T 1) Where Δ H is the heat energy needed to heat an object of mass m and specific heat capacity c p from T 1 to T 2. For a pot with water these energies would need to be … WebDec 16, 2010 · Enthalpy of water at 20 *C and athmospheric pressure from mollier: 86,6 kJ/kg. Enthalpy of saturated steam (100*C): 2676,1 kJ/kg. DeltaH= 2676,1 - 86,6 = 2589,5 kJ/kg. 3 litres of water = 3kg so: 2589,5 kJ/kg * 3 kg = 7768,5 kJ required to boil 3 litres of water. Using the equation Q=mcΔT we can calculate the amount of energy for heating the water to 100 degrees. c=4187 Joules per kilogram- the specific heat capacity of water. ΔT = 100-43=57, how many degrees we must increase the water by to make it boil and turn into steam.

Ewa Staszewska Digital reporter less than 2 min read chemistry beaker typesWebWater heater Calculation: Water heater power P (kW) in kW is equal to the 4.2 times of the quantity of water L in Liters and the temperature difference divided by 3600. Hence, the required power to heat the different temperature formula can be written as, P (kW) = 4.2 x L x (T 2-T 1) / 3600. T 1 = Initial water temperature. T 2 = Final water temperature..
